About the artist: Donald L. Dickson (Col, USMCR) (1906 – 1974) Donald L. Dickson, USMCR, graduated in 1924 from the School of the Worcester Art Museum. He enlisted in the Marine Corps Reserve in 1927. Dickson landed with the 1st Marine Division on Guadalcanal and participated in the invasion of Guam and Tinian. He fought on Roi-Namur with the V Amphibious Corps. After World War II, Dickson accepted a position with Curtis Publishing Company but was recalled to active duty during the Korean War. He served as the editor of Leatherneck magazine until he retired in 1965. Dickson died in 1974.
